More details can be found on xUnit’s GitHub page. xUnit is used by .NET core as the default testing framework and its major advantage over NUnit is ... incra router table the worksWebb31 aug. 2024 · Data-driven test methods in XUnit are called theories and are adorned with the Theory attribute 2. The Theory attribute is always accompanied by at least one data attribute which tells the test runner where to find data for the theory. There are three built-in attributes for providing data: InlineData, MemberData, and ClassData. incra® miter 1000se with telescoping fenceWebb16 juli 2024 · In the context of the Xunit testing framework, the Theory attribute is used to define a parameterized test method.
